Objective To explore the relationship between intrarenal arterial resistive indeces (RIs), pusatility indeces (PIs) and the Chronic Allograft Damage Index (CADI) of protocol biopsy early after renal transplantation. Secondly, to compare the predicting value of long-time renal function and graft survival between these indeces.Methods We retrospectively analysed 132 renal transplant recipients,who underwent RI and PI assessment within 22±11 days after transplantation, and protocol biopsy within 39±13 days. The relationship between RIs, PIs and CADI was explored. During the 69±22 months after transplantation, the predicting value of long-time renal function and graft survival between these indeces was also compared.Results The intrarenal arterial RIs and PIs were significantly correlated, both RIs and PIs were significantly correlated with CADI.The renal arterial RI and PI were significantly correlated with the estimated Glomerular Infiltration Rate (eGFR) 0-6 years after transplatition, although CADI were not. After calculating the Relative Risk (RR), we found the renal arterial RI and PI were the strongest predictior of the prognosis. When the patients were subdivided to RI> 0.7 and PI> 1.4, we found the patients had lower RIs and PIs would be haven higher eGFR, they had more chances to occur acute rejection, protenuria (>1g/d), serum creatinine increase>50%, and graft lost (P<0.05).Conclusion Compared to CADI, renal arterial RI and PI has better predictive value for recipients of primary and secondary endpoints, such as acute rejection, protenuria (>1g/d), serum creatinine increase>50%, and graft lost.
